متن کاملCalreticulin binds to gentamicin and reduces drug-induced ototoxicity.
Aminoglycosides like gentamicin are among the most commonly used antibiotics in clinical practice and are essential for treating life-threatening tuberculosis and Gram-negative bacterial infections. However, aminoglycosides are also nephrotoxic and ototoxic.
